Energy consumed by the sensor nodes are more sporadic in a sensor networks. A skilled way to bring down energy consumption and extend maximum life-time of any sensor present can be of evenly and unevenly distributed random area networks. Cluster heads are more responsible for the links between the source and destination. Energy consumption are much compare to member nodes of the network. Re-clustering will take place if the connectivity in the distributed network failure occurs in between the cluster networks that will affects redundancy in the network efficiency. Hence, we propose pragmatic distribution based routing cluster lifetime using fitness function (PDBRC) prototype is better than the existing protocol using MATLAB 2021a simulation tool.

Modern methods of raspberry protection aim at a substantial reduction of chemicals use. The investigation on potential biological control of phytophagous mites on this crop has been begun. Field studies on the occurrence, species composition, and density of populations of tetranychid mites (Tetranychidae) and phytoseiid mites (Phytoseiidae) in different areas of raspberry growing in Poland was carried out in 2000-2001. Leaf samples were collected from 71 plantations located in five of the main regions of Polish raspberry production. There were clear differences in the densities of tetranychid mite populations between regions, with raspberry spider mite Neotetranychus rubi (Trag.) being more numerous than two-spotted spider mite Tetranychus urticae (Koch.) in most except the Skierniewice region. Among the phytoseiid mites collected from raspberry leaves, eleven species were identified. Although their occurrence and species composition varied with region, Amblyseius bryophilus Karg, Euseius finlandicus (Oudemans) and Amblyseius andersoni (Chant) were the most common; each species occurred at least in three regions. Results obtained showed good prospects for the deployment of the phytoseiids in biological control of spider mites on raspberry.

Gender and representing the feminine in legal and administrative texts in Italy – The paper examines the linguistic treatment of the genre (delimiting the concept to ‘female’, ‘woman’) at various levels of legal communication, through the analysis of legal and administrative texts of different kinds produced in Italy in the 20th and 21st centuries (codes, sentences, regulations, etc). The survey focuses on lexical aspects and is supported by lexicographical research.
